After Kol Uprising in 1831, the parganas of Ramgarh, Kharagdiha, Kendi and Kunda became parts of the South-West Frontier Agency before being renamed to Hazaribag, which became the administrative headquarters. The <a href="page.php?w=Kharagdiha">Kharagdiha</a> <a href="page.php?w=Rajas">Rajas</a> were settled as Rajas of Raj Dhanwar in 1809, and the Kharagdiha gadis were separately settled as zamindari estates.
